Women's Basketball Falls to Saint Vincent 65-61

PITTSBURGH, Pa. - December 7, 2022 - Chatham Women's Basketball came up at home against Saint Vincent 65-61 Wednesday night. The Cougars are now 5-3 on the season and 3-2 in the PAC.

First year forward Alyssa Laukus led the Cougars in points, with 17, and rebounds, with seven. Sophomore guard Aurielle Brunner led the team with five assists, and added seven points and three steals. Brunner leads the PAC with 39 steals on the year.

The Cougar offense struggled in the first quarter against the stout Bearcat defense, scoring just five points. However, Chatham's offense bounced back over the next two quarters, scoring 20 in the second and 24 in the third to cut the Saint Vincent lead to one heading into the fourth. The Cougars led by four with six minutes to play, but an 8-0 run from the Bearcats down the stretch proved to be too much.

Saint Vincent blocked 11 shots in the game. Chatham had not had more than five shots blocked in a game this season. The Cougars narrowly won the turnover battle 21-20, but were out rebounded 43-40.

Women's Basketball will hit the road for a noon contest on Saturday against Wooster in Ohio.
